Why Baking Soda and Vinegar?

Baking soda and vinegar are both powerful cleaning agents on their own, but when combined, they create a reaction that can lift stains, neutralize odors, and disinfect surfaces. Baking soda is slightly alkaline, which helps to break down dirt and grease, while vinegar is acidic and can dissolve mineral deposits, soap scum, and other tough residues.

The Science Behind the Reaction

When baking soda (sodium bicarbonate) and vinegar (acetic acid) are mixed together, they create a chemical reaction that produces carbon dioxide gas, water, and sodium acetate. The foaming action that occurs during this reaction helps to physically lift dirt and stains from surfaces, making them easier to clean.
